Irishhttp://www.blogger.com/profile/05850837083033234484noreply@blogger.comBlogger1125t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-6278074931282592220.post-54991074455730469162008-05-16T13:01:00.000-07:002008-05-16T13:01:00.000-07:00Well, an addendum to this is that KRF only pays $2...Well, an addendum to this is that KRF only pays $200 a day -- divided by 6 people, that's about $33 each per day -- barely covering gas to get there.<BR/><BR/>Though this does kind of suck, and smaller faires have paid us more, we kind of realized that this is still an opportunity no matter how we slice it. We can earn extra money by passing the hat around, and selling trinkets. <BR/><BR/>If we do well, we can make a lot of money, and become well-known, and maybe well-liked. I heard that big faires are like this with new acts. We're unproven. Since they liked our audition, they are going to give us a chance to become famous, using their show as a stepping stone. If we are as good as our audition, they will gladly pay us more next year, or we can pit competing faires against each other, and see who wants to pay us more. <BR/><BR/>So we just need to work on our hat-passing skills, and hope everything holds together.David W.
